In this Quick Spoon, Ross explores the second skill in the McIntosh Leadership Framework: Awareness.

Inspired by a reflection from Gabriella Braun, this episode looks at the leadership power of noticing what’s happening beneath the surface — in ourselves, in teams, and in the wider system around us.

So often, leaders feel pressure to speak quickly, solve problems, and drive action.

But what if better leadership sometimes starts with noticing more… and saying less?

Ross shares a practical experiment to help leaders develop awareness in meetings, conversations, and everyday workplace dynamics.
